EU: deadly bird flu strain confirmed in Germany
submited by pub4world at Jun, 24, 2007 21:14 PM from Reuters
BRUSSELS, June 24 (Reuters) - The highly pathogenic bird flu virus H5N1 has been found in two dead swans in Germany, the European Commission said on Sunday. The European Union executive said German authorities had informed Brussels that laboratory tests carried out at a regional laboratory in Bavaria had confirmed the deadly strain in the birds. Precautionary measures were now being taken, the Commission said in a statement.
